1. GENERAL
The project envisages installation of mechanical instruments as per guideline, installation of blank new
front panel, cut holes for secondary instruments, and existing items that are to remain, remove old front
panels, remount existing alarm & control elements, mount new secondary instruments, re-wire existing
equipment & wire new ones, replace primary & secondary field instruments, re-wire & perform loop
checks. The work methodology and equipment planning for various works is based on the site conditions
prevailing in the project area. Work activities are planned in such a way that project will be completed in
the shortest possible time period. The following assumptions have been made for the method
statement.
All the pre-execution activities like hook up diagram, new wiring & termination diagram has been
completed, all new instruments to be installed is available at job site.
2. OBJECTIVE
This document provides guidance in implementing an effective program for all project execution. This
includes addressing programs for the following:
(1) Implementing commitments regarding the quality of the weld joints, Cable termination etc.
(2) Ensuring personal safety and PPE for everyone.
(3) Managing and providing oversight to ensure installation and related quality control have been
adequately addressed by specifications, drawings, and procedures;
(4) Managing and providing supervision and control to assure qualification of welders; and
(5) Recording installation and test activities.
This procedure is one component of a complete installation and inspection program. This and other
procedures will be used, as needed, to provide assurance that all activities are being conducted as
required by the specification and manufacturer procedures. It is not expected that completion of the
entire procedure will be accomplished during any one inspection and/or every time the inspection
procedure is used. It is a continuing activity until all piping networks and instruments are installed and
tested.
5. Qualification of Personnel
The Supervisor will verify that the personnel have sufficient knowledge of the procedure requirements.
The Supervisor will review any training and qualification records for those individuals who shall do the
task to determine whether they are skilled enough to follow the procedure before the actual work is
carried out.

7. Description of Activities
a) Check all pipes and fittings to be used for joint are free from defects, dents or deformities and
are straight. Remove pipes and fittings with defects and replace with acceptable materials.
b) Remove foreign matter or dirt from inside of the pipe and fittings before fit up.
c) For longer work breaks, place suitable stoppers to prevent debris, earth or water from entering
pipe open ends.
d) Welding electrodes shall be stored and handled as per Manufacturers instructions.
e) Cut the pipes to the required length using an appropriate pipe cutter, or profile cutter (OxyAcetylene), allowing for provision of pipe fitting later. Works shall be carried out in accordance
with the approved shop drawings.
f)
The pipes shall be checked by the assigned foreman for its square-ness and straightness, after
being cut to the correct angle and site requirements.
g) Remove old instruments and secure connected cables and mark them properly
h) Connect new instruments and pipe fittings according to provided drawing
i) Rewire new instruments
j) Disconnect devices mounted on panels and secure cables after proper marking.
k) Cutout front panel according to supplied drawing and install new ones.
l) Mount new devices and Rewire using existing cables
